The Maligned Marine is the second novel in the Mercy and Justice Mystery series, a contemporary small town mystery series. The series is a sequel to the Father Tom Mysteries that began with The Penitent Priest and includes the same cast of characters. It features Father Tom Greer, a Catholic Priest who is also an amateur sleuth in the tradition of Father Brown, and his wife Helen Greer, female Chief of Police and detective in the tradition of Kinsey Millhone.

Another great read in the Mercy and Justice Series from J. R. & Susan Mathis. Fr. Tom Greer and his wife, Chief of Police Helen Greer are on the trail of another killer in Myerton. Dexter Huckleberry, controversial pastor of The Elect Fellowship, has been murdered. Gary Stevens, former Marine and friend of Steve Austin, has been arrested for the murder. Steve is owner of the Hoot-n-Holler Bar and latest target of Dexter for his eroding of traditional family values by virtue of being gay and running a gay bar, which the Hoot-n-Holler is not. And yet, there are many other possible suspects, including the pastor’s widow, ex-wives and an elder of the church. And then, the finances of the church are somewhat suspect too. Some of Myerton’s best return, including detective Dan, Gladys and her teal bullhorn, Anna in the parish office, pastor Clark and his wife Vivian and Dr. Martin, trauma surgeon.
